Output bb96e424a2342dff971b8ce7064991eceea221193aa37192a413bdd8f25d0fc3:1

value
570469235
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7aafdaa63ca418740d5b08254aacd8bc5542ad9c OP_EQUAL
address
MK5sLPbvZGjHLGkQgPkZfePYNi3zQ6DzXZ
transaction
bb96e424a2342dff971b8ce7064991eceea221193aa37192a413bdd8f25d0fc3
spent
true